Artillery is a secondary skill that gives the hero manual control over war machine Ballista during combat and control over the arrow towers when defending a town during siege. Basic Artillery provides a 50% chance that ballista inflicts double damage. For Advanced Artillery this is a 75% chance and for Expert Artillery a 100% chance. Advanced and Expert Artillery also enable the ballista to shoot twice in a row, instead of once.
Heroes with Artillery as a starting skill:
Arlach the Overlord – Basic Artillery
Christian the Knight – Basic Artillery
Gerwulf the Beastmaster – Basic Artillery
Gurnisson the Barbarian – Basic Artillery
Ignissa the Planeswalker – Basic Artillery
Pasis the Planeswalker – Basic Artillery
Pyre the Demoniac – Basic Artillery
Vokial the Death Knight – Basic Artillery
Zubin the Battle Mage – Basic Artillery
Ranloo the Death Knight - Basic Artillery
Jeremy the Captain - Basic Artillery
